(2 hours ago)jcole05 Wrote: So - that's kind of the heart of the question I guess.  Since I've just purchased a rose RS151, I'm tempted to use its DAC.  Theoretically, bc I also own a W4S ST1000 amp I could remove the D200 entirely.  But given its depreciation over the years, I'd prefer to keep it I think. 

Thus, the question about how viable the strategy is to use only part of it (rs151 as streamer/DAC/pre and D200 as amp VS rs151 only as streamer and D200 as integrated; VS other possibilities where the ST1000 is the power amp).

But combining the responses from thumb5 and G51 - if the D200 will convert the analog signal back to digital anyway, what does this mean on a technical level?  Is the RS151's DAC influencing the sound signature at all in this case?  To anyone knowledgable I know these are very basic questions.

I wouldn't say they are very basic questions; they are reasonable questions for anyone interested in sound quality to ask.  That's what I was hinting at when I said that the extra analog-digital-analog conversions done inside the Devialet "should be completely transparent with no effect on sound quality".

Some people are happy that given the sample rate of these conversion and the quality of the Devialet's design and components, there is no audible degradation in which case you will hear the sound quality of the source - the RS151's DAC in your case.  Others fret about all such conversions introducing artefacts which might mask or degrade the sound quality of the source.

All I can say is unless you have some high quality measuring gear and the time and inclination to investigate it technically, the only real way to answer that question for yourself is to listen to both configurations and decide based on what you hear.
